HTML pentru începători – ghid rapid 2026

HTML pentru începători ghid rapid 2026

Publicat pe: 09 Feb 2026 | 291 vizualizări | ~5 min. lectură

Orice drum în lumea dezvoltării web începe cu HTML. Este primul limbaj pe care îl înveți, fundația pe care se construiește tot ceea ce înseamnă un site: structură, design, funcționalitate și experiență. Dacă te gândești la un site ca la o casă, HTML este scheletul ei – elementul fără de care nimic nu ar putea exista.

De aceea, chiar dacă tehnologia evoluează rapid și apar framework-uri moderne sau instrumente avansate, HTML rămâne punctul de plecare pentru oricine vrea să creeze ceva pe internet. Este simplu, logic și prietenos cu începătorii, iar odată ce îl înțelegi, tot restul devine mult mai clar.

Pentru cei care vor să aprofundeze, IB‑Media oferă un curs HTML complet și gratuit, ideal pentru începători. Îl poți accesa aici: Curs HTML gratuit.

1. Ce este, de fapt, HTML

HTML este un limbaj de marcare, adică un mod prin care îi spui browserului cum să organizeze și să afișeze conținutul unei pagini. Nu programezi în sensul clasic, ci descrii ce reprezintă fiecare parte a paginii: un titlu, un paragraf, o imagine, o listă sau o secțiune.

Browserul citește aceste instrucțiuni și construiește pagina pe care o vezi. Este un proces simplu, dar extrem de puternic, pentru că îți permite să creezi structura oricărui site, de la cele mai simple până la cele mai complexe.

<!DOCTYPE html>
<html>
  <head>
    <title>Prima mea pagină</title>
  </head>

  <body>
    Bine ai venit în HTML!
  </body>
</html>

2. Cum arată o pagină HTML modernă

Orice pagină HTML este împărțită în două zone mari: partea invizibilă, unde se află informațiile tehnice și setările paginii, și partea vizibilă, unde se află conținutul pe care îl vede utilizatorul. Această structură este aceeași pentru orice site, indiferent de complexitate.

În partea vizibilă se află tot ceea ce compune o pagină: titluri, texte, imagini, butoane, meniuri și secțiuni. În partea invizibilă se află informații precum titlul paginii, setările pentru mobil, descrierea pentru motoarele de căutare și alte detalii importante.

<meta 
  name="description" 
  content="Descrierea paginii tale">

<meta 
  name="viewport" 
  content="width=device-width, initial-scale=1.0">

3. Elementele de bază pe care trebuie să le cunoști

Ca începător, nu trebuie să înveți sute de elemente. Este suficient să înțelegi câteva concepte simple:

  • Titlurile – organizează conținutul pe niveluri, de la titlul principal la subtitluri.
  • Paragrafele – reprezintă blocurile de text obișnuit.
  • Linkurile – permit navigarea între pagini sau către alte site-uri.
  • Imaginile – adaugă conținut vizual.
  • Listele – sunt utile pentru enumerări, pași sau idei.
  • Secțiunile – împart pagina în zone logice, ușor de înțeles.

Aceste elemente sunt suficiente pentru a crea primele tale pagini și pentru a înțelege cum funcționează structura unui site.

<h1>Acesta este un titlu</h1>

<p>Acesta este un paragraf de text.</p>

<a 
  href="https://www.ib-media.com">
  Vizitează IB‑Media
</a>
<img 
  src="imagine.jpg" 
  alt="Descrierea imaginii">

4. De ce contează HTML semantic

Pe măsură ce înveți, vei descoperi că nu este important doar să afișezi conținutul, ci și să îl organizezi corect. HTML semantic înseamnă să folosești elementele potrivite pentru rolul lor: un antet pentru partea de sus a paginii, o secțiune principală pentru conținut, un articol pentru o bucată de text independentă sau un subsol pentru informațiile de final.

Acest lucru ajută la:

  • o structură mai clară a paginii
  • o experiență mai bună pentru utilizatori
  • o înțelegere mai bună din partea motoarelor de căutare
  • o accesibilitate crescută pentru persoanele care folosesc cititoare de ecran
<header>Zona de sus a paginii</header>

<main>
  Conținutul principal
</main>

<footer>Informații de final</footer>

5. Greșeli frecvente ale începătorilor

La început, este normal să faci mici greșeli. Cele mai comune sunt:

  • folosirea excesivă a elementelor generice în locul celor semantice
  • lipsa unei structuri clare a paginii
  • neglijarea optimizării pentru mobil
  • utilizarea imaginilor fără descriere alternativă
  • amestecarea elementelor fără o logică vizuală sau semantică

6. Concluzie

HTML este primul pas în dezvoltarea web și baza pe care se construiește totul. Dacă înțelegi structura unei pagini, rolul elementelor și importanța semanticii, vei avea un start solid în orice direcție vrei să mergi: design, front-end, back-end sau chiar dezvoltare de aplicații complexe. Este un limbaj simplu, prietenos și ideal pentru a-ți începe călătoria în lumea web-ului.

Distribuit de 0 ori

Adaugă comentariu

Fii primul care comenteaza!

Must Read

Interop 2026: un pas decisiv pentru un web unificat

Interop 2026: un pas decisiv pentru un web unificat

Interop 2026 aduce un set ambițios de standarde comune pentru browsere, promițând un web mai coerent, mai rapid și mai previzibil pentru dezvoltatori și utilizatori. Află ce noutăți aduce ediția din acest an și cum influențează viitorul web‑ului.

Citește articolul
Evoluțiile majore în AI & Tech din februarie 2026

Evoluțiile majore în AI & Tech din februarie 2026

Cele mai importante evoluții AI și tehnologice din februarie 2026: ascensiunea AI‑ului agentic, investițiile uriașe ale companiilor Big Tech și schimbările strategice care modelează viitorul industriei.

Citește articolul
CSS în 2026 – analiza utilizării reale: tendințe, cifre și concluzii

CSS în 2026 – analiza utilizării reale: tendințe, cifre și concluzii

Analiză completă a modului în care CSS este folosit în proiectele reale în 2026: tendințe, tehnologii moderne, probleme frecvente, framework-uri dominante și concluzii despre starea actuală a CSS-ului pe web.

Citește articolul
React în 2026 – ce trebuie să înveți cu adevărat

React în 2026 – ce trebuie să înveți cu adevărat

Află ce trebuie să înveți cu adevărat pentru a lucra cu React în 2026: JavaScript modern, Hooks, Next.js, TypeScript, state management și proiecte practice care te pregătesc pentru un job real în IT.

Citește articolul